CCTV in Blythe Road

11.03.00am GMT Sun 9th Mar 2008

Denise Joy - Blythe Road

Denise Joy reports that she has been contacted by residents suggesting that mobile CCTV camera points should be provided in Blythe Road to enable the deployment of mobile CCTV cameras.

Denise says, "Following calls from residents, the Borough Council has surveyed the road and the provision of mobile CCTV camera points would be possible but before proceeding with this I and my colleagues would like to know the views of local residents as to whether or not they would support this suggestion, and if so whether residents have a particular view as to the most appropriate location(s) bearing in mind that the camera points do need a power supply and thus are normally mounted on lamp posts.
